Overview of Prada and Balenciaga

Prada is an Italian luxury fashion house founded in 1913, known for its sophisticated designs and high-quality materials. The brand has a reputation for blending traditional craftsmanship with contemporary aesthetics, often appealing to a clientele that values timeless elegance.

Balenciaga, on the other hand, is a Spanish luxury brand that has gained prominence for its avant-garde designs and bold fashion statements. Established in 1919, Balenciaga has become synonymous with innovation and has a strong following among younger consumers who are drawn to its edgy and sometimes controversial styles.

Pricing Strategies in 2025

Prada's Pricing Approach

Prada has maintained a premium pricing strategy that reflects its heritage and commitment to quality. In 2025, the average price point for Prada products, including ready-to-wear, handbags, and accessories, remains high. Here are some key aspects of Prada's pricing strategy:

Consistency in Pricing

Prada tends to maintain consistent pricing across its product lines, which helps reinforce its luxury status. This consistency is crucial for brand loyalty, as customers expect to pay a premium for the Prada name.

Limited Discounts

The brand rarely offers significant discounts or sales, which helps to preserve the perceived value of its products. This strategy positions Prada as a brand that is not easily accessible, further enhancing its allure.

Investment Pieces

Many Prada items are considered investment pieces, with their value often appreciating over time. This has led to a customer base that sees purchasing Prada as not just a fashion choice but a financial decision as well.

Balenciaga's Pricing Strategy

Balenciaga, while also a luxury brand, adopts a slightly different approach to pricing. In 2025, the brand is known for its bold pricing tactics, which often reflect current fashion trends and consumer demand:

Dynamic Pricing

Balenciaga employs dynamic pricing strategies, adjusting prices based on market trends and the popularity of specific items. This can lead to significant price variations across different collections.

Collaborations and Limited Editions

The brand frequently collaborates with other designers or brands, creating limited-edition items that can command higher prices due to their exclusivity. This strategy attracts collectors and fashion enthusiasts willing to pay a premium for unique pieces.

Youthful Appeal

Balenciaga's pricing often targets a younger demographic, which can sometimes be more price-sensitive. The brand balances this by offering a range of products at various price points, making luxury fashion more accessible to a broader audience.

Value Proposition

When comparing the value offered by Prada and Balenciaga, several factors come into play:

Quality and Craftsmanship

Both brands are known for their exceptional quality and craftsmanship, but they approach it differently:

  • Prada emphasizes traditional craftsmanship, using high-quality materials and techniques that have been honed over decades. This results in products that are not only stylish but also durable.
  • Balenciaga, while also focused on quality, often leans towards innovative materials and experimental designs. This can sometimes lead to mixed perceptions of quality, particularly with more avant-garde pieces.

Brand Prestige and Image

The prestige associated with each brand plays a significant role in consumer perception:

  • Prada is often viewed as a classic luxury brand, appealing to customers who value heritage and timeless style.
  • Balenciaga, with its bold and sometimes controversial designs, appeals to a younger, trend-conscious audience looking for statement pieces that stand out.

Customer Perceptions

Understanding how customers perceive value in relation to price is crucial:

Prada's Customer Base

Customers who choose Prada often seek a blend of classic style and investment potential. They are willing to pay a premium for products that align with their values of quality and tradition.

Balenciaga's Customer Base

Balenciaga attracts a younger clientele that values innovation and trendiness. Customers are often willing to pay higher prices for exclusive items that allow them to express their individuality.
